Why You Need an Asbestos Attorney Lawyer

A mesothelioma lawyer can help asbestos victims receive financial compensation. Victims should seek legal representation from national firms that specialize in asbestos cases.

A good mesothelioma lawyer will offer a free case evaluation to determine whether you qualify for compensation. The best mesothelioma attorneys also operate on a contingent basis. This arrangement increases the amount of compensation offered to clients.

1. Experience

If you or a loved one has mesothelioma or asbestosis or another asbestos-related disease it is essential to engage an expert lawyer to help you obtain compensation. Asbestos sufferers can sue companies who exposed them to asbestos. This will cover the financial loss they suffer.

Asbestos victims are given a limited amount of time to file a claim, or risk being denied the right to take legal actions. A New York asbestos lawyer can assist you in filing your claim within the legal deadlines and ensure that all relevant law is followed.

Mesothelioma lawyers are familiar dealing with the complicated rules and regulations governing asbestos litigation. They have the expertise to collect evidence and present an argument that is convincing to judges and juries. An attorney who is highly rated has a track record in helping clients receive fair and full compensation for their losses.

A number of the most reputable mesothelioma law firms have offices in New York, including Weitz & Luxenberg, Cooney & Conway, and Simmons Hanly Conroy. They have a team consisting of paralegals and attorneys who can assist you in filing a lawsuit against asbestos in the state that is most likely to be successful.

Asbestos litigation is a worldwide practice, and the majority of large mesothelioma law firms have a national presence. However, it is essential to hire an asbestos attorney who has an office in your area and is able to meet with you in person, if possible. Local offices allow you to be more comfortable discussing your case and make the process easier by removing some of anxiety associated with travel.

Ask the candidates about their asbestos litigation experience during the interview. Find out the firm's strategy for each case, and how it intends to fight on your behalf. Find out who will handle your case. Case managers that are not lawyers are usually employed by large firms. Also, find out how quickly they respond to phone and email messages.

A mesothelioma lawsuit or verdict can cover medical bills as well as lost income as well as home care, travel expenses funeral and burial costs loss of quality of life and other losses. Many victims receive compensation in the millions.

2. Reputation

If you're looking for the most favorable outcome for your mesothelioma case, hire a law office with years of experience and a national presence. These asbestos lawsuit firms are specialized and have a deep understanding of asbestos litigation, and the way it differs from state to state. This streamlined process can help you save time and stress as you pursue compensation. This lets you concentrate more on your family, and medical care, instead of trying to navigate the legal system.

Mesothelioma attorneys with a strong reputation have a track record of winning compensation for victims and their families. They have access to a wealth of resources such as industry records and historical data. They have the experience and knowledge to identify asbestos companies accountable and file an action in the form of a trust fund or lawsuit. They are motivated by justice and seek to hold asbestos producers accountable for their negligence. As an example asbestos lawyer Joseph D. Satterley is personally affected by the disease due to his grandfather's diagnosis of mesothelioma. He has racked up several multimillion-dollar verdicts in mesothelioma cases, including the first jury verdict ever against Colgate-Palmolive for the popular Cashmere Bouquet Talcum Powder.

The ideal mesothelioma attorney has a positive outlook, listen to your concerns and respond to questions promptly. They will be able to explain the various options for financial compensation, including filing a mesothelioma lawsuit, trust fund claims and VA benefits. They will also be in a position to provide instructions on how to claim compensation prior to the time that the statute of limitations expires.

A good mesothelioma law firm will offer a no-cost case assessment to help you determine if you're qualified to start a lawsuit or file a trust fund claim. Top law firms won't charge you any upfront fees for reviewing your case, since they work on a contingent basis. This means that they only get paid when you receive compensation. This is a cost-effective way to ensure the highest amount of compensation that is possible.

4. Flexibility

Workers diagnosed with asbestos-related diseases or mesothelioma can seek compensation for the companies who exposed them to this carcinogen. This can include compensation for medical bills, loss of income, loss consortium as well as pain and suffering and funeral expenses.

A knowledgeable mesothelioma lawyer will identify all parties liable for your damages and guide you through the lawsuit or settlement process. Asbestos-related illness claims often require a complex legal process and may take years to complete. A good lawyer will fight for you and your loved ones until justice is achieved.

The best mesothelioma attorneys will have the expertise and resources needed to ensure the highest value of your case. The track record of a lawyer's experience in fighting for victims of asbestos exposure will give you peace of knowing that he is the right option to handle your case.

asbestos legal lawyers have been known to receive millions of dollars in settlements for their clients. They also have been successful in obtaining significant verdicts in court. Some mesothelioma attorneys specialize exclusively in asbestos-related cases, while others cover a broad range of practice areas and specialize in representing clients suffering from various types of illnesses.

Make an appointment for a personal interview after you have a list of potential candidates. Bring your medical records, employment history and any other pertinent documents to the interview. Ask the lawyers to explain how they anticipate your case will progress and the timeframe to reach an agreement. Be sure to inquire about fees and costs.
